如何选择最佳开发管理系统?5个关键因素助你事半功倍

如何选择最佳开发管理系统?5个关键因素助你事半功倍

在当今快速发展的软件行业中,选择一个合适的开发管理系统对于提高团队效率和项目成功率至关重要。本文将为您详细解析选择最佳开发管理系统的5个关键因素,帮助您在众多选择中找到最适合自己团队的解决方案。

功能全面性:满足团队多样化需求

一个优秀的开发管理系统应该能够满足团队的多样化需求。它不仅要包含基本的项目管理功能,还应该提供代码版本控制、持续集成/持续部署(CI/CD)、测试管理、文档协作等全面的功能模块。

例如,ONES 研发管理平台就提供了从需求管理到代码集成、测试管理再到发布部署的全流程支持,满足了不同角色和不同阶段的管理需求。在选择时,您需要仔细评估自己团队的实际需求,确保所选系统能够覆盖团队工作中的各个环节。

易用性和学习曲线:提高团队适应效率

系统的易用性直接影响到团队成员的使用积极性和工作效率。一个优秀的开发管理系统应该具有直观的界面设计、清晰的功能布局和简单的操作流程。这不仅能够减少团队成员的学习时间,还能够提高日常工作的效率。

在评估系统易用性时,可以考虑以下几个方面:

1. 界面设计是否清晰直观
2. 常用功能是否易于访问
3. 是否提供详细的用户指南和教程
4. 是否有完善的客户支持服务

选择一个易用性高的系统,可以大大缩短团队的适应期,让成员更快地投入到实际工作中。

可定制性和扩展性:适应团队成长需求

每个团队都有其独特的工作流程和管理需求,而这些需求还会随着团队的发展而不断变化。因此,一个理想的开发管理系统应该具有良好的可定制性和扩展性,能够根据团队的实际情况进行灵活调整。

在评估系统的可定制性时,可以关注以下几个方面:

1. 是否支持自定义工作流程
2. 是否允许添加自定义字段
3. 是否提供API接口,支持与其他工具集成
4. 是否支持插件或扩展开发

选择一个具有良好可定制性和扩展性的系统,可以确保它能够随着团队的成长而不断适应新的需求,避免未来因系统限制而影响团队效率的情况发生。

开发管理系统

安全性和数据保护:保障团队核心资产

在选择开发管理系统时,安全性和数据保护是不容忽视的重要因素。系统中存储的项目信息、代码资产等都是团队的核心机密,必须得到妥善保护。

在评估系统安全性时,可以关注以下几个方面:

1. 是否支持多因素认证
2. 是否提供细粒度的权限控制
3. 数据传输和存储是否加密
4. 是否有定期的安全审计和漏洞修复机制
5. 是否符合相关的数据保护法规(如GDPR)

选择一个安全可靠的系统,可以有效降低数据泄露和安全事故的风险,为团队的核心资产提供强有力的保护。

性能和可靠性:确保系统稳定运行

开发管理系统的性能和可靠性直接影响到团队的工作效率。一个优秀的系统应该能够保证稳定的运行,即使在高并发的情况下也能保持良好的响应速度。

在评估系统性能和可靠性时,可以关注以下几个方面:

1. 系统的响应速度是否满足需求
2. 是否能够支持团队规模的并发访问
3. 系统的正常运行时间(uptime)是否有保证
4. 是否有完善的备份和恢复机制
5. 供应商是否提供服务级别协议(SLA)

选择一个性能优秀、可靠性高的系统,可以最大限度地减少因系统问题导致的工作中断,保证团队工作的连续性和效率。

综上所述,选择最佳开发管理系统是一个需要综合考虑多个因素的复杂过程。功能全面性、易用性、可定制性、安全性以及性能可靠性这五个关键因素,能够帮助您更好地评估和选择适合自己团队的系统。在选择时,建议您结合团队的实际需求和未来发展规划,权衡这些因素,做出最佳决策。记住,一个优秀的开发管理系统不仅能够提高团队的工作效率,还能够为项目的成功提供强有力的支持。选择合适的开发管理系统,将为您的团队带来事半功倍的效果。